Gilmore’s career with the Patriots was nothing short of legendary. His time in New England began in 2017 when he was brought in as a highly coveted free agent after a successful stint with the Buffalo Bills. From day one, Gilmore proved to be worth every penny. He quickly established himself as the top cornerback on the Patriots’ defense, earning a reputation for his physicality, intelligence, and ability to lock down the opposing team’s top receivers.

His performance in the Patriots’ Super Bowl LIII victory was one of the defining moments of his career, as he played a crucial role in shutting down the Rams’ high-powered offense. That game, which ended with a 13-3 Patriots win, featured Gilmore’s superb coverage and an interception in the final moments, solidifying his place as one of the best cornerbacks in the game. His work in the postseason only added to his reputation as a clutch player.

Throughout his time in New England, Gilmore earned numerous accolades, including three Pro Bowl selections and an All-Pro First Team honor in 2019. His 2019 season was particularly stellar, as he led the league in interceptions and was named the NFL Defensive Player of the Year. That season was a testament to his elite skill set, as he not only shut down top receivers week in and week out but also consistently made game-changing plays for his team.

Gilmore’s success was not limited to his time with the Patriots. After leaving New England in 2021, he continued his career with the Carolina Panthers and later the Indianapolis Colts, though his time with those teams was much shorter. Even in those final years, Gilmore’s impact was still evident, as he remained a solid contributor to whichever defense he was a part of.
